The Squier Sonic™ Bronco® Bass is ready to launch any musical adventure into warp speed, offering iconic Fender® style and inspiring tone for players at any stage. This Bronco Bass sports a slim and inviting “C”-shaped neck profile with a narrow 1.5" nut width and a thin, lightweight body for optimal playing comfort while a Squier® single-coil pickup delivers punchy bass tone. Further details of this model include a short 30" scale length, 4-saddle hardtail bridge for precise intonation adjustment, sealed-gear tuning machines for smooth, accurate tuning and durable chrome-plated hardware that is sure to catch the spotlight.

Neck

NECK MATERIAL: Maple

NECK FINISH: Satin Urethane

NECK SHAPE: "C" Shape

NECK CONSTRUCTION: Bolt-On

FINGERBOARD RADIUS: 9.5" (241 mm)

FINGERBOARD MATERIAL: Maple

NUMBER OF FRETS: 19

NUT WIDTH: 1.5" (38.1 mm)

NUT MATERIAL: Synthetic Bone

Body

BODY: Poplar

BODY FINISH: Gloss Polyurethane

BODY SHAPE: Bronco™ Bass

Hardware

TUNING MACHINES: Die-Cast Sealed

STRINGS: Nickel Plated Steel (.045-.105 Gauges)

Electronics

NECK PICKUP: Ceramic Single-Coil

PICKUP CONFIGURATION: S

CONTROLS: Master Volume, Master Tone

Fender Musical Instruments Corporation Inc. (FMIC) is an internationally operating US company in the musical instrument industry based in Scottsdale (Arizona). The company is often referred to as "Fender" for short, synonymous with their core brand. FMIC was founded in 1946 by broadcast electrician and inventor Leo Fender under the name Fender Electric Instrument Manufacturing Company in Fullerton, California. Through the original innovations of Leo Fender, the company has grown into one of the most recognized manufacturers of electric guitars, electric basses, guitar amplifiers and PA systems. Since the 1990s, through targeted acquisitions of well-known brands in the musical instrument industry, FMIC has developed into one of the world's largest groups in the industry via the products of the core brand "Fender".
